The major organ of the nervous system encased in the skull is the brain.

The brain is a complex organ responsible for controlling various bodily functions, processing sensory information, generating thoughts and emotions, and coordinating voluntary and involuntary actions.

It is a crucial component of the central nervous system and plays a central role in overall human functioning.
